#dcd6f3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dcd6f3 is composed of 86.3% red, 83.9%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.5%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 252.4 degrees, a saturation of 54.7% and a lightness of 89.6%. #dcd6f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b9ade7.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#dcd6f3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dcd6f3 has RGB values of R:220, G:214,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 14472947.
